导读:
【mysql数据库关联查询 mysql关联后数据条数】在实际的数据库应用中 , 经常需要将多个表中的数据进行关联查询 , 以便获取更加丰富的信息 。而关联后的数据条数则是一个非常重要的指标,它可以帮助我们判断查询效率和结果是否符合预期 。本文将介绍如何使用MySQL进行关联查询,并探讨关联后数据条数的计算方法 。
1. MySQL关联查询
MySQL支持多种关联查询方式,包括内连接、左连接、右连接、全连接等 。其中最常用的是内连接和左连接 。下面分别介绍这两种方式的语法:
- 内连接:SELECT * FROM table1 INNER JOIN table2 ON table1.id = table2.id;
- 左连接:SELECT * FROM table1 LEFT JOIN table2 ON table1.id = table2.id;
2. 关联后数据条数的计算方法
在进行关联查询时,我们可能会遇到关联后数据条数不符合预期的情况 。这时就需要仔细分析查询条件和数据结构 , 找出问题所在 。一般来说,关联后数据条数的计算方法如下:
- 内连接:结果集中的行数等于两个表中符合条件的记录数的乘积 。
- 左连接:结果集中的行数等于左表中符合条件的记录数加上右表中符合条件的记录数 。如果右表中没有符合条件的记录 , 则返回NULL值 。
3. 总结
本文介绍了MySQL关联查询和关联后数据条数的计算方法 。在实际应用中 , 我们需要根据具体情况选择合适的关联方式,并注意关联后数据条数是否符合预期 。这样才能保证查询效率和结果的准确性 。
推荐阅读
- mysql数据表中的约束 mysql知识点约束
- mysql查询行转列列不固定 mysql查询行
- mysql建表1067 mysql建表建时间
- mysql联合查询使用的关键字是什么 mysql查询修改联合